Transaction 89493c679ab713b1a51baeaea70016e10e108981b9820c7e65d3edc9c81b6823

2 Input
2 Outputs
  • 89493c679ab713b1a51baeaea70016e10e108981b9820c7e65d3edc9c81b6823:0
  • value  4019616
    address  1AEfgvaTcPYjSYmrCaLpd8LbeCgehhiPmM
  • 89493c679ab713b1a51baeaea70016e10e108981b9820c7e65d3edc9c81b6823:1
  • value  1179149
    address  17nKo7GKLkaDJBxPR4DJatwkVxsQSDU3eA